Inscribe and Amazon Bedrock Partnership

Inscribe, a leader in AI-powered document fraud detection, has forged a strategic partnership with Amazon Web Services (AWS) to leverage Amazon Bedrock. This collaboration has enabled Inscribe to construct an advanced agentic AI system specifically designed to detect tampered, fabricated, and AI-generated financial documents. By harnessing the capabilities of Amazon Bedrock, Inscribe has achieved a remarkable 20x improvement in fraud detection efficiency, significantly reducing review times from approximately 30 minutes to under 90 seconds per application. The Growing Threat of Document Fraud

Document fraud poses a significant threat to businesses across various industries. According to Inscribe’s 2026 State of Document Fraud Report, fraud is present in 1 out of every 16 documents. The threat has escalated with the rise of AI-generated forgeries, which grew fivefold from April to December 2025. This surge in sophisticated fraud methods highlights the critical need for advanced detection systems that can quickly and accurately identify fraudulent documents. Model Selection and Usage

Inscribe strategically utilizes various models from Amazon Bedrock to optimize its fraud detection system. For high-volume operations like document parsing and initial classification, Inscribe employs Anthropic Claude Haiku 4.5. For transaction enrichment and entity extraction, Meta Llama 3.1 70B and Meta Llama 4 are used. Finally, Anthropic Claude Sonnet 4 and 4.5 are employed for cross-document fraud analysis and multi-step reasoning workflows. This thoughtful model selection ensures that each aspect of the fraud detection process is handled by the most appropriate and efficient AI tool, enhancing the overall effectiveness and accuracy of the system. AWS Infrastructure Support

Inscribe’s fraud detection system is supported by a robust AWS infrastructure. Document ingestion and storage are managed through Amazon S3, ensuring secure and scalable storage solutions. Processing jobs are created and queued using Amazon SQS, facilitating efficient workflow management. The web application is served through Amazon CloudFront and an Application Load Balancer, providing high availability and performance.
